Zero Waste Forum
As part of the Zero Waste Forum organized by the Zero Waste Foundation, Studio Blai developed modular display and event elements that transformed the themes of sustainability and the circular economy into a physical spatial experience. Designed in line with the forum’s goal of making environmental awareness and resource circulation visible, the system was produced entirely from recycled plastic panels. Creating wayfinding, display, and public interaction points throughout the event space, the modular structure was designed for reuse after the event. The project became a concrete example that highlights waste not only as a problem to be reduced, but as a resource containing new design and production potential. As part of the installation, 1,500 kg of plastic waste was transformed into long-lasting spatial elements.
